Cooking the Shrimp with Garlic

The cooking part is quick. The key is not to overcook the shrimp. Let’s look at the step-by-step method. Here’s how you will actually cook shrimp with garlic.

Sautéing the Garlic in Butter

First, melt the butter in a pan. Add the garlic and cook until fragrant. This step releases the garlic flavor. This will create the main flavor base for your shrimp with garlic.

Adding the Shrimp to the Pan

Add the shrimp to the pan. Cook until pink. This usually takes about 2-3 minutes. Be careful not to overcook the shrimp in your shrimp with garlic.

Seasoning the Shrimp

Season the shrimp with salt and pepper. Add other seasonings if you like. Toss everything together. This will create a wonderful dish. The seasoning will bring out the flavors when you make shrimp with garlic.

What is Greek garlic sauce made of?

Greek garlic sauce, often called “skordalia,” is typically made from garlic, potatoes or bread, olive oil, and vinegar or lemon juice. It’s usually thick and creamy. Specifically, it is a good sauce to use for a Mediterranean style dish. Therefore, this variation offers a different take on garlic sauce.
